Do the children benefit from a mediated divorce?

Yes. Couples find that one of the most important (and personally fulfilling) aspects of divorce mediation is the opportunity for the parents to create a sound parenting plan that will ameliorate some of the traumatic changes faced by the children of divorcing parents. In a traditional adversarial divorce, important decisions about the children's futures are often taken out of the parents' hands and made by judges and lawyers. In divorce mediation, the two people who best know the children and their needs ...the parents, work together to create a plan that will best serve the needs of the children.
